Electrical Safety in Plumbing Systems
Plumbing systems aren’t protected from electrical hazards. The use of electrical appliances such as water heaters and pumps can be a source of electric shock or fire in the event that they are not grounded correctly. Electrical current can flow through water and metal pipes which pose a threat to those who come in close contact. Grounding can help protect you from electrical hazards by offering the lowest resistiveness for electric current to flow. When properly grounded, excess electrical current is directed out of the system for plumbing and into the ground, decreasing the risk of electrical shock or fire.

The requirement for grounding is applicable to Plumbing Systems
The specific requirements for grounding in plumbing systems are outlined in different codes and regulations. In the National Electrical Code (NEC) provides guidelines for grounding in plumbing systems, which includes the use of grounding electrodes and conductors. The NEC requires that all piping made of metal which are energized can be grounded to an electrode such as an earthing rod or water pipeline. The grounding conductor must connect to the grounding electrode and to the ground for electrical service. It is important to note that plumbing systems must be grounded in compliance with local codes and regulations. Failure to comply with these requirements can result in dangerous safety risks and legal ramifications.
Common Grounding Problems
Common problems in plumbing grounding can be caused by improper installation or installation, the deterioration of components for grounding, and lack of maintenance. When grounding components get damaged or corroded they could not work as intended, leaving the plumbing system vulnerable to electrical hazards. Poor grounding can also cause an excessive amount of electrical noise, which can lead to issues with electrical equipment and appliances. In extreme cases, poor grounding could result in electrical arcing and sparking which can lead to fire hazards.
